基本问题

我想将大型列表粘贴到excel中,但是它们都粘贴到同一个单元格中,如何将它们粘贴到不同的单元格中。 以网站https://www.doogal.co.uk/BatchGeocoding.php为例,其中包含以下设置:

选项卡(用于直接粘贴到Excel中)

输入地址关闭

英国东部和北部

与视图文本

这允许将数字放入不同的单元格中。 如何在python中重新创建它,以便我可以复制输出并粘贴到Excel工作表中。 我尝试在输出之间放置4个空格并在它们之间添加 t。 例如52.660869 1.26202和52.660869 t 1.26202但它们粘贴到同一个单元格中。

我希望这个输出直接粘贴到excel 52.522229,-1.448947,'vZR6L','GTS','Owner','london','0','x',就像网站一样

我试过了

52.522229    -1.448947    vZR6L    GTS    Owner    london    0    x

52.522229 \t -1.448947 \t vZR6L \t GTS \t Owner \t london \t 0 \t x

52.522229\t-1.448947\tvZR6L\tGTS\tOwner\tlondon\t0\tx

当我粘贴到Excel 2016时,是不是被识别为列分隔符?

与python的关系是什么? 不要粘贴到Excel,使用csv模块创建一个制表符分隔文件,并使用excel打开该文件,这将工作。

我只是让python对数字运行一堆测试,然后输出结果。 我希望将输出的文本直接粘贴到excel中。

你确定你的标签没有被你粘贴它们的实际内容转换成空格吗? 因为如果是,Excel将不会将其识别为列分隔符。

看起来它正在被转换为空格,这就是为什么我试图使用 t来代替分割列表

然后,您所要做的就是更改输出事物中的设置,以便不将标签转换为空格。 或者将其粘贴到允许它并更改它的编辑器中。 但同样,最好将其输出到制表符分隔文件,而不是像其他评论者所说的那样手动粘贴。

我做了一些研究,据我所知,不可能从命令行实现你想要的东西。 问题是即使您在代码中指定\t,命令行也会将制表符作为空格输出。

>>>my_string ="THIS\tIS\tA\tTEST"

>>> print(my_string)

THIS....IS......A.......TEST

在这个例子中,.是空格。 Excel无法解析此问题。

选项1

我假设你在窗户上。 如果是这样,您可以将输出通过管道传输到Windows clip程序中。

>>>import os

>>>my_string ="THIS\tIS\tA\tTEST"

>>>os.system("echo {} | clip".format(my_string))

0

这会将字符串复制到剪贴板。 在我的测试中,这是有效的:我不知道它对你有多好。

对于其他操作系统,请参阅:管道进出剪贴板

选项2

或者,您可以将输出写入文件,其中实际将保存TAB字符:

with open("results.txt") as f:

f.write(my_string)

但此时,您可以将逗号分隔并将其另存为.csv:

my_string ="THIS, IS, A, TEST"

with open("results.csv") as f:

f.write(my_string)

@Shanded我对不起就这样了。 我写了这篇独立的评论。

因为剪辑的东西,我取消了我的downvote。

python 复制粘贴excel_关于python:对于excel粘贴到新单元格相关推荐

  1. Excel VBA:插入新单元格或区域——Range.Insert 方法

    Range.Insert 方法 在工作表或宏表中插入一个单元格或单元格区域,其他单元格相应移位以腾出空间. 语法 表达式.Insert(Shift, CopyOrigin) 表达式   一个代表 Ra ...

  2. python 拆分excel单元格_Python怎么在Excel中把一个单元格里的内容拆分提取?:excel表格已拆分的数据提取...

    Python怎么在Excel中把一个单元格里的内容拆分提取? 有规律的话写代码可以处理,没有就没有办法 如何将EXCEL表中的数据分离出来? 如图,B1输入:=LEFT(A1,FIND("排 ...

  3. python使用xlwings提取excel表中所有单元格的数据

    有时我们需要使用一个excel表中所有单元格的数据来进行操作,可以使用循环来实现,我对比了一下,使用xlwings直接提取成列表,速度最快. 记录一下我的操作. Excel数据(测试数据)如图,有部分 ...

  4. C#/VB.NET 复制Excel中的指定单元格区域

    本文介绍C#及VB.NET程序代码来复制Excel中的指定单元格区域,包括复制单元格文本及单元格样式.复制时,可在工作簿中的同一个sheet工作表内复制,也可在不同工作簿的不同sheet工作表间复制. ...

  5. python pptx 关于在ppt里插入表格,调整合并单元格的问题

    python pptx 关于在ppt里插入表格,调整合并单元格的问题 需求 找到合并了的单元格 思路 判断是否是合并单元格 合并位置的记录 合并 代码 需求 首先我这是为了从word里面将内容导到pp ...

  6. 合并的表格怎么加横线_excel表格如何在数据之间加横线-在excel里怎么添加单元格横线...

    在EXCEL中,如何批量给数字中间加横线? 在编辑EXCEL有时部分文字我们需要的要将其划掉,也就是字上画一条,下面给大家介绍一下如何操作 方法/步骤 打开excel,找到需要编辑的内容 点击&quo ...

  7. 计算机基础知识教程excel单元格拆分,电脑内怎么将excel表格中某个单元格的内容拆分至不同单元格里...

    电脑内怎么将excel表格中某个单元格的内容拆分至不同单元格里 当我们在使用电脑的时候,可以下载excel软件来处理数据文件,那么如果想要将一个单元格中的内容拆分到不同的单元格中的话,应如何操作呢?接 ...

  8. 怎么在html的表格中加筛选,excel中表头合并单元格的筛选

    EXCEL中表头合并,怎么实现筛选数据? 亲,如下面的动画演示,选中第5行,点击菜单"数据","筛驯. excel中有合并单元格的行怎么才能筛选整个表格其中 直接对合并过 ...

  9. Excel 中如何根据单元格内容删除行

    根据单元格内容快速删除行,首先需要选中含有该单元格内容的所有行,然后删除.似乎在 Excel 当中除了 VBA 以外没有其他更快捷的方法能解决这个问题了.这里将推荐几个快速根据单元格内容删除行的方法给 ...

  10. 在Excel中填写空白单元格以完成表格

    If you've imported data into Excel, you might need to clean it up before you can use it. Here's how ...

最新文章

  1. ABAP 开发时遇到的错误记录
  2. 关于spring读取配置文件的两种方式
  3. 如何解决Bluetooth系统设计的棘手问题
  4. Druid 在spring中的配置
  5. C# XML添加删除/SelectNodes/xpath
  6. local lua 多个_Lua面向对象之多重继承、私密性详解
  7. c语言for嵌套循环语句,关于for嵌套循环语句的疑问
  8. html 圆饼画布,html5 canvas画饼
  9. IpV6 linux RedHat5
  10. linux没有.brashrc文件,Linux 安装 Redis4.0.6
  11. 深度优先搜索(DFS)与广度优先搜索(BFS) -- 总结
  12. 强烈抗议故意审核不通过
  13. 21天学通JAVA-第7版 入门到精通完美高清PDFamp;光盘源代码下载
  14. 病房呼叫系统数电设计(含报告)
  15. html去除背景颜色怎么设置,文档底色怎么去掉【解决思路】
  16. spring中 allowBeanDefinitionOverriding(spring.main.allow-bean-definition-overriding)原因分析、解决办法
  17. IAT HOOK、EAT HOOK和Inline Hook
  18. Python Numpy的数组array和矩阵matrix
  19. 浅析webpack的原理
  20. 存在阿里云OSS的视频截取一张图片作为封面

热门文章

  1. 职业经理人需要学习的内容--哈佛MBA课程设置
  2. 【生活工作经验 八】掌握大局,MBA考前调研
  3. TPS2061CDBVR电源开关
  4. 【模拟集成电路】分频器(DIV_TSPC)设计
  5. [原创] 给偏色美女调色 五步搞定
  6. 高铁JRU设备的作用
  7. 可以预见的未来(连续剧-1)
  8. 闪存增寿 - Wear Leveling磨损均衡
  9. Qt QPushButton按钮用法详解
  10. 基于 java springboot+layui+jquery实现二手物品网站系统